CWE-90
Improper Neutralization of Special Elements used in an LDAP Query ('LDAP Injection')
The product constructs all or part of an LDAP query using externally-influenced input from an upstream component, but it does not neutralize or incorrectly neutralizes special elements that could modify the intended LDAP query when it is sent to a downstream component.

"value": "maddy is a composable, all-in-one mail server. Versions prior to 0.9.3 contain an LDAP injection vulnerability in the auth.ldap module where user-supplied usernames are interpolated into LDAP search filters and DN strings via strings.ReplaceAll() without any LDAP filter escaping, despite the go-ldap/ldap/v3 library\u0027s ldap.EscapeFilter() function being available in the same import. This affects three code paths: the Lookup() filter, the AuthPlain() DN template, and the AuthPlain() filter. An attacker with network access to the SMTP submission or IMAP interface can inject arbitrary LDAP filter expressions through the username field in AUTH PLAIN or LOGIN commands. This enables identity spoofing by manipulating filter results to authenticate as another user, LDAP directory enumeration via wildcard filters, and blind extraction of LDAP attribute values using authentication responses as a boolean oracle or via timing side-channels between the two distinct failure paths. This issue has been fixed in version 0.9.3."

Mitigation ID: MIT-5
Phase: Implementation
Strategy: Input Validation
Description:
- Assume all input is malicious. Use an "accept known good" input validation strategy, i.e., use a list of acceptable inputs that strictly conform to specifications. Reject any input that does not strictly conform to specifications, or transform it into something that does.
- When performing input validation, consider all potentially relevant properties, including length, type of input, the full range of acceptable values, missing or extra inputs, syntax, consistency across related fields, and conformance to business rules. As an example of business rule logic, "boat" may be syntactically valid because it only contains alphanumeric characters, but it is not valid if the input is only expected to contain colors such as "red" or "blue."
- Do not rely exclusively on looking for malicious or malformed inputs. This is likely to miss at least one undesirable input, especially if the code's environment changes. This can give attackers enough room to bypass the intended validation. However, denylists can be useful for detecting potential attacks or determining which inputs are so malformed that they should be rejected outright.
CAPEC-136: LDAP Injection
An attacker manipulates or crafts an LDAP query for the purpose of undermining the security of the target. Some applications use user input to create LDAP queries that are processed by an LDAP server. For example, a user might provide their username during authentication and the username might be inserted in an LDAP query during the authentication process. An attacker could use this input to inject additional commands into an LDAP query that could disclose sensitive information. For example, entering a * in the aforementioned query might return information about all users on the system. This attack is very similar to an SQL injection attack in that it manipulates a query to gather additional information or coerce a particular return value.
